Supported by exhaustive archival documentary data the given scientific work sheds light on the origin (1921), development and liquidation (1935) of the unique organization created by the Bolshevistic authorities for the purpose of formation of "new Communist" history based on the Slavonic tradition and at the same time interpreted from the point of view of the Communist ideology. This peculiar society was composed not only of "old" Bolshevistic convicts but also Mensheviks, anarchists (anarcho-communists and anarcho-syndicalists), right-wing and left-wing socialist revolutionists as well as of bundists (members of the European Jewish socialist movement founded in Russia in 1897). Such famous political figures as J.Stalin, A.R.Gots, F.E.Dzerzhinskii, L.D.Trotskii, V.N.Figner and E.D.Stasova belonged in their time to the legendary organization.
